How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Durham?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Downtown Durham Studio Apartments | $1,541 | $799 | $3,282 |
| Downtown Durham 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,633 | $795 | $4,715 |
| Downtown Durham 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,115 | $850 | $4,867 |
| Downtown Durham 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,689 | $1,300 | $7,395 |
| Downtown Durham 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,202 | $1,700 | $2,521 |
